When I updated the firewall last time I neglected to re add ports 443 and 80. LetsEncrypt needs those open to authorise the domain before issuing the cert. It should do it automatically again in July (it did in February).

More than 20,000 students have been told they were given maintenance loans and grants in error and now face demands to immediately pay the money back. The students, who are all studying weekend courses, received letters from the Student Loans Company (SLC) or their university saying their courses had never been eligible for maintenance loans or childcare grants. One letter, from the SLC and seen by the BBC, says the student's university provided incorrect information and "unfortunately, they didn't tell us you only attended on the weekend". It states that any "over-payment" will have to be repaid. The BBC understands courses at 15 universities and colleges including London Met, Bath Spa, Leeds Trinity, Southampton Solent and Oxford Brookes are affected. The courses each had in-person teaching at weekends, and some also had online learning during the week. Students had signed up for these courses and taken out loans for maintenance and, in some cases, grants for childcare. In a joint statement issued via Universities UK, the institutions involved told the BBC the issue stemmed from an "abrupt" decision by the government and that they were considering a legal challenge. However, the Department for Education said students had been let down by "incompetence or abuse of the system".

First Lady Melania Trump has denied connections to Jeffrey Epstein, telling reporters at the White House that any claims linking the two "need to end today". In a surprise announcement on Thursday, the first lady called for congressional hearings for survivors of Epstein's sex trafficking. She also denied online rumours that Epstein introduced her to Donald Trump, calling them "mean-spirited attempts to defame my reputation". It is unclear what prompted the announcement. There was no prior indication from her office that she would make a statement on Epstein, and the White House did not share the topic earlier when her remarks were put on its daily schedule. She said she had not been a victim of Epstein, with whom she only briefly "crossed paths" in 2000. "I have never had any knowledge of Epstein abuse of his victims," she said. "I was never involved in any capacity. I was not a participant." She also denied knowing Ghislaine Maxwell, the disgraced financier's jailed associate. She referred to a 2002 email between her and Maxwell released in the Epstein files, calling it nothing more than "casual correspondence" and a "polite reply". An email that appears to be the one she referenced is addressed to "G" - presumably for Ghislaine - and includes compliments about a story featuring "JE" with a photo of G that appeared in New York Magazine. She wrote that she "cannot wait" to go to Palm Beach. "Give me a call when you are back in NY," the email says. "Have a great time! Love, Melania" The New York Magazine article included quotes from now-President Donald Trump calling Epstein a "terrific guy" and saying "he's a lot of fun to be with".

Hungarian Prime Minister Viktor Orbán has conceded defeat after 16 years in power, with the opposition securing a landslide election win. Péter Magyar, a former Orbán ally who became his fiercest critic, swept to victory promising closer ties to the EU, and his win opens the door to more European support for Ukraine. With more than 98% of the votes counted, Magyar's party Tisza is set to win a massive majority in parliament - this is an astonishing achievement, our central Europe correspondent writes. Record numbers turned out for an election which was seen as pivotal to the future of Hungary and Europe - our Russia editor Steve Rosenberg says Orbán's defeat is a blow to Vladimir Putin. Magyar is on course for a two-thirds majority - that means the new government will be able to reverse Orbán's reforms, writes our Europe digital editor

A 35-year-old ultra-marathon champion from Dumfries has died while running in the Highlands. David Parrish was trying to beat the record for the fastest man to complete the Cape Wrath trail, a 234 mile (376km) route from Fort William to Cape Wrath. The former Royal Marine was found in the remote mountainous area of Kintail in the north-west Highlands on Saturday. Police Scotland said he was found in the area at about 22:25. "There are no suspicious circumstances and his next of kin are aware," a statement added.
